[Faithwire.com] An Iowa principal who was hailed a hero after risking himself to save his students has died. (Image: Pixabay)
Principal Dan Marburger passed away Jan. 14, 10 days after a 17-year-old gunman entered Perry High School in Perry, Iowa, killing a sixth grader and injuring seven others, CNN reported.
"Although the news has not fully set in yet, Dan Marburger gave the ultimate sacrifice," a statement on a GoFundMe page created to benefit Marburger's family read. "After 10 days, he lost his battle, and this tragedy took his life."
The statement went on to note that the family will face the "unfathomable" situation in the days, weeks, and years to come and praised the principal's selfless acts. Those deeds included taking steps to try and protect students when the gunman entered the school earlier this month.
"Dan endured significant injuries in the tragic events at Perry High School on Thursday, January 4, putting himself in harm's way to ensure as many students and staff could safely exit the building," the statement read.
